WebFeb 22, 2024 · Nepalese cuisine is a unique blend of flavors and ingredients influenced by the country's diverse geography, culture, and history. It is characterized by its use of staple ingredients like rice, lentils, and maize, as well as spices and herbs such as cumin, coriander, ginger, and garlic. Chatamari is a thin crepe made from a batter of eggs, rice flour, ginger and garlic paste, and a variety of powdered spices.

WebDec 21, 2024 · This ancient dish is the highlight of the festival of lights- Tihar. Sel roti is semi-liquid type rice flour spiced with cinnamon or cardamom. For elevating the taste, cream, sugar, and banana are added to the mixture. Rings of this sel roti mixture are added to the oil and fried till golden and served. 5.
